que - Navegación de enlace de Android y entrada de cuadro en internet
convertir fotos en pinturas gratis (0)
¿Cómo puedo hacer que Android "navegue" a través de enlaces en el sitio web? Supongamos que la primera actividad en mi aplicación permite al usuario ingresar su nombre de usuario y contraseña, que luego se almacenarán en cadenas. Luego, la aplicación "ingresa" las cadenas en los cuadros de nombre de usuario y contraseña y "hace clic" en el botón de inicio de sesión en el sitio web. Este "llenado" y "clic" se realizarán en segundo plano, mientras el usuario ve una pantalla de carga. Esta es la idea básica. Entonces, ¿cómo conseguiría que la aplicación "complete" los cuadros de nombre de usuario y contraseña y "haga clic" en el botón de inicio de sesión?
Además, no soy el propietario del sitio web en el que estoy ingresando. Mi aplicación simplemente solicitaba un nombre de usuario y una contraseña, y dejaba que el usuario iniciara sesión en el sitio web, que es un elemento de libro de calificaciones en línea para que los estudiantes vean. Es una aplicación de conveniencia. También quiero que esta sea una aplicación nativa de Android.
Ok, esta es una descripción general de cómo se verá la aplicación:
Actividad 1 : el usuario simplemente ingresa el nombre de usuario y la contraseña (sin diseño web, nada; solo dos editTexts)
- Presiona el botón de inicio de sesión -
Actividad 2 : necesito navegar a un determinado sitio de Internet e iniciar sesión sin que el usuario tenga que iniciar sesión en el sitio web; deseo crear una interfaz de usuario (actividad 1) donde se llenen las credenciales de inicio de sesión. En esta actividad, quiero de alguna manera alimentar estas credenciales.
Entonces, esencialmente, necesito iniciar sesión en este sitio web en mi propia IU, y transferir esa información al sitio web. Eventualmente, una vez que haya iniciado sesión, necesitaré usar el código .html de la página de inicio de sesión ...
Nota: Como ya se mencionó, no tengo acceso a la base de datos del sitio web, etc. ya que no soy propietario y no estoy afiliado al sitio web.